码迷,mamicode.com
首页 >  
搜索关键字:usart    ( 195个结果
串口初始化结构体和固件库讲解
常用的6个函数,结构体: USART 初始化结构体(USART_InitTypeDef) USART 时钟初始化结构体(USART_ClockInitTypeDef) 串口使能函数void USART_Cmd(USART_TypeDef* USARTx, FunctionalState NewSta ...
分类:其他好文   时间:2018-04-29 14:28:43    阅读次数:188
串口(USART)框图的讲解
STM32 的 USART 简介 通用同步异步收发器(Universal Synchronous Asynchronous Receiver and Transmitter)是一个串行通信设备,可以灵活地与外部设备进行全双工数据交换。有别于 USART 还有一个 UART(Universal Asy ...
分类:其他好文   时间:2018-04-29 12:03:34    阅读次数:5399
输入捕获
#include "timer.h"#include "led.h"#include "usart.h" //TIM14 PWM部分初始化 //PWM输出初始化//arr:自动重装值//psc:时钟预分频数void TIM14_PWM_Init(u32 arr,u32 psc){ //此部分需手动修 ...
分类:其他好文   时间:2018-04-08 00:17:58    阅读次数:204
TIM3定时器
#include "stm32f4xx.h"#include "sys.h"#include "delay.h"#include "usart.h"#include "led.h"#include "timer.h" int main(void){ NVIC_PriorityGroupConfig( ...
分类:其他好文   时间:2018-04-03 23:46:23    阅读次数:393
STM32下多串口用法
一个项目用到32下的多个串口,一般STM32C8T6型号拥有3个USART,串口的配置都很简单,但是要使用的话就得解决他们之间的矛盾, printf函数到底输出在哪一个串口中? 先看这函数: 在我们使用printf函数的时候,首先必须重定义fputc函数,在这个函数中,实现数据的发送,然后在 USA ...
分类:其他好文   时间:2018-03-25 00:00:54    阅读次数:225
STM32串口发送中断
今日进行串口数据通信时,使用DMA串口485发送完成中断进行485发送至接收的状态转换时发现,当DMA传输完成时,串口发送寄存器中的数据还未通过发送端口传输完成,在中断中需等待查询串口发送的状态,while((USART_GetFlagStatus(USART1,USART_FLAG_TC) != ...
分类:其他好文   时间:2018-03-01 23:26:50    阅读次数:282
2.14 正点原子ESP8266模块的STA模式 调试3
1.重新了解了usart串口的代码(这里用usart1代码为例) USART1_IRQHandler(串口1中断函数代码) 此代码解析参考网站http://blog.sina.com.cn/s/blog_776077610102vgqg.html 个人理解:这个代码就是以第14位(0-15)是否收到 ...
分类:其他好文   时间:2018-02-14 21:05:01    阅读次数:408
stm32的HAL库的注意点
(一)、uart / usart 要注意的 API使用方法。 1.__HAL_UART_GET_FLAG 是获取 SR 寄存器标志位状态 2.__HAL_UART_CLEAR_FLAG 是清除 SR 寄存器标志位状态 3.__HAL_UART_CLEAR_xxFLAG ,xx为PE FE NE OR ...
分类:其他好文   时间:2018-01-19 14:08:15    阅读次数:346
MDK,关于 STM32F4 配置失败, GPIO, USART 写入值没反应
需要先将RCC->AHB1ENR寄存器的对应时钟打开! 下面做个测试: 配置GPIO实验 没有打开时钟使能,配置无反应: 打开时钟使能后,可以成功写入数据: 配置USART实验 RCC 未开启时钟: RCC 开启时钟后: 发现TC标志位置1,说明成功写入。 ...
分类:其他好文   时间:2018-01-06 16:38:52    阅读次数:237
USART通信
Usart --串口(通用同步/异步串行接收/发送器) 由两根线组成(RX接收线/TX发送线) USART是一个全双工通用同步/异步串行收发模块,该接口是一个高度灵活的串行通信设备. 全双工操作(相互独立的接收数据和发送数据); 同步操作时,可主机时钟同步,也可从机时钟同步; 独立的高精度波特率发生 ...
分类:其他好文   时间:2017-12-09 20:58:50    阅读次数:155
195条   上一页 1 ... 6 7 8 9 10 ... 20 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!